James Houston - Eskimo Woman, Shamanjok with Child on Her Back, Original Drawing, 1949 - An original graphite and coloured pencil drawing on paper by James Houston (Canadian, 1921-2005), inscribed: “Eskimo woman Shamanjok with child on her back at the Innuksuak River, Eastern Hudson Bay, 6 Feb. 1949”. Sheet measures 7.25 x 9.5 in. (sight), matted to 15.5 x 13.25 in. Signed “J. Houston” lower right. Created during Houston’s pivotal early years in the Eastern Arctic, this rare field drawing predates the formal establishment of Inuit printmaking in Cape Dorset. Houston’s 1948-1950 expeditions were instrumental in documenting Inuit life and directly led to the development of the Inuit print program. Works from this period are of exceptional historical and cultural significance, capturing firsthand ethnographic observations. Provenance: Private Canadian collection. Comparable works are held in the collections of the Canadian Museum of History and the Winnipeg Art Gallery.
